Harting ix Industrial Series Ethernet Cable, 3m Length, 26AWG American Wire Gauge - 33483131805030
This Ethernet Cable is a Cat6a model, providing a reliable connectivity solution for high-speed networks. With a length of 3m, it features terminated ends for immediate use. Designed specifically with automation and industrial applications in mind, this shielded cable meets IEC standards and is constructed from durable PVC material.

How does the shielded design improve performance in demanding environments?
The shielded construction minimises electromagnetic interference, ensuring data integrity and transmission quality, especially in industrial settings where radio frequency noise may be prevalent.
What type of connections can I expect with this cable?
It features male connectors on both ends, specifically Type A plugs, allowing for easy connection to standard networking equipment without the need for additional adaptors.
What gauge size does this Ethernet Cable utilise, and why is it important?
The cable uses a 26AWG (American Wire Gauge), which strikes a balance between flexibility and performance, making it suitable for a variety of installation scenarios without compromising signal quality.
Can this cable be used in outdoor settings?
While the PVC sheath provides a good level of protection, the cable is not specifically rated for outdoor use
it is recommended for indoor applications to ensure optimal performance and durability.
